什麼是 IaaS(基礎結構即服務)?

基礎結構即服務 (IaaS) 是指託管在雲端的伺服器和儲存體。

學習目標

閱讀本文後,您將能夠:

  • 瞭解 IaaS 的含義
  • 探索 IaaS 在雲端服務模型中的適用位置
  • 瞭解如何將 IaaS 整合到多雲端和混合雲端部署中

相關內容


想要繼續瞭解嗎?

訂閱 TheNET,這是 Cloudflare 每月對網際網路上最流行見解的總結!

請參閱 Cloudflare 的隱私權政策,了解我們如何收集和處理您的個人資料。

複製文章連結

基礎結構即服務 (IaaS) 是什麼意思?

在運算中,基礎結構是指執行程式碼和儲存資料的電腦和伺服器,以及在這些機器之間建立連線的電線和設備。例如,伺服器、硬碟器和路由器都是基礎結構的一部分。在雲端運算成為一種選擇之前,大多數企業都託管自己的基礎結構,並在內部執行所有應用程式。

基礎結構即服務 IaaS

基礎結構即服務(簡稱 IaaS)是指雲端運算廠商代表其客戶託管基礎結構的情況。廠商在「雲端」託管基礎結構——換句話說,在各種資料中心中。他們的客戶透過網際網路存取此雲端基礎結構。他們可以使用它來建置和託管 Web 應用程式、儲存資料、執行業務邏輯或執行可以在傳統內部部署基礎結構上完成的任何其他操作,但通常具有更大的靈活性。

雲端運算有哪些主要模型?

雲端運算的三種主要服務模式是:

雲端運算服務模型

IaaS、PaaS 與 SaaS

IaaS 是託管在雲端的基礎結構。IaaS 包括虛擬伺服器雲端儲存雲端安全性以及對資料中心資源的存取(由 IaaS 提供者管理)。

平台即服務 (PaaS) 是雲端運算服務模型中的下一層。它為開發人員提供了一個建置應用程式的平台。大多數 PaaS 產品包括開發工具、中介軟體、作業系統、資料庫和資料庫管理以及基礎結構。PaaS 提供者可以自行管理基礎結構,也可以將其作為服務從 IaaS 提供者處購買。

軟體即服務 (SaaS) 是在雲端託管和管理的完整應用程式。SaaS 使用者訂閱應用程式並透過網際網路存取,而不是購買一次並在本地安裝。

開發人員和企業為什麼要使用 IaaS?

可擴展性:以 IaaS 為基礎擴展業務要容易得多。企業不必在每次業務需要擴展時都購買、安裝和維護新伺服器,只需透過 IaaS 提供者按需新增新伺服器即可。這種隨需可擴展性是所有雲端服務模型的雲端運算的主要優勢。

專用於伺服器維護的資源更少:使用 IaaS,公司基本上將伺服器購買、維護和更新外包給 IaaS 提供者。這通常更便宜,並且與託管自己的基礎結構相比,內部團隊需要的時間和工作量更少。

加快上市時間:使用 IaaS 的公司可以更快地部署和更新應用程式,因為雲端提供者可以根據需要提供任意數量的基礎結構。

IaaS 如何適用多雲端和混合雲端部署?

多雲端部署和大多數混合雲端部署涉及整合多個雲端服務。許多採用多雲端方法的企業與一個雲端提供者合作來獲得 IaaS,並在此基礎上與 PaaS 和 SaaS 服務整合。一些公司還可能與多個 IaaS 提供者合作,以實現備援或並行處理單獨的運算工作負載。

使用混合雲端的企業可以將 IaaS 與內部部署基礎結構或私人雲端以及其他公用雲端服務相整合。

Cloudflare 如何支援 IaaS?

Cloudflare 位於任何類型的雲端基礎結構前方,可加速流量、防範惡意攻擊並確保可靠性。Cloudflare 可以與任何 IaaS 提供者一起部署。

進一步瞭解 Cloudflare 如何與多雲端和混合雲端部署整合以及如何在不考慮基礎架構性質的情況下擴展網路連線